From 2398edeacca136eefe1a548721976ffe297ea36d Mon Sep 17 00:00:00 2001 From: Kristof Provost Date: Sat, 13 Apr 2019 19:04:20 +0200 Subject: sys/freebsd: Add pf ioctl()s Tweak the building of the FreeBSD vm image to ensure pf is loaded at startup, so that we can test it. --- pkg/build/freebsd.go | 2 ++ 1 file changed, 2 insertions(+) (limited to 'pkg') diff --git a/pkg/build/freebsd.go b/pkg/build/freebsd.go index 4f3cb6a54..73e234b2c 100644 --- a/pkg/build/freebsd.go +++ b/pkg/build/freebsd.go @@ -64,6 +64,8 @@ sudo mount /dev/${md}p${partn} $tmpdir sudo MAKEOBJDIRPREFIX=%s make -C %s installkernel KERNCONF=%s DESTDIR=$tmpdir +echo 'pf_load="YES"' | sudo tee -a /boot/loader.conf + sudo umount $tmpdir sudo mdconfig -d -u ${md#md} `, objPrefix, kernelDir, confFile) -- cgit mrf-deployment